ATTENTION: The incorrect configuration of these parameters can cause
an overspeed condition. They must be configured by a qualified person
who understands the significance of configuring them. Failure to observe
this precaution could result in bodily injury.

ARM

VOLTAGE

GAIN

ADJ

(P.204)

Scales the armature
voltage signal after
the drive hardware
conditions the signal.
In most cases, this
parameter is set to
1.000.

Parameter Range:

0.750 to 1.250

Default Setting:

1.000

Parameter Type:

Tunable

OIM Menu Path(s):

Speed/Voltage Loop (

SPD

) - Speed/Voltage Loop

(

SPD

) Feedback

Important: Adjust the zero point (

ARM

VOLTAGE

ZERO

ADJ

(P.205)) before

configuring gain.

ARM

VOLTAGE

ZERO

ADJ

(P.205)

Removes any offset
from the armature
voltage signal.

Parameter Range:

–200 to 200

Default Setting:

0

Parameter Type:

Tunable

OIM Menu Path(s):

Speed/Voltage Loop (

SPD

) - Speed/Voltage Loop

(

SPD

) Feedback

If

ARMATURE

VOLTAGE

(P.289) is not equal to zero when the drive is stopped, adjust

ARM

VOLTAGE

ZERO

ADJ

up or down until

ARMATURE

VOLTAGE

(P.289) equals zero.
